I've got a 2006 TRX 250 EX which has some issues. I've throughly cleaned the carb and am still having engine stalling at low rpm. It will start with the choke on but needs reved continuously to keep it going. The engine backfires and doesn't rev as it should at higher rpm. The air box and K&N are clean. It seems similar to a mistimed cam. My belief is my rev happy daughter has jumped the timing while stuck in the mud. I'll need some info as to pulling the engine apart to replace the cam chain and look for possible other damage. The engine sounds fine mechanically and doesn't smoke. I plan on checking the valve clearance first and do a compression check before getting serious. I have the tech data for checking the timing and valves but will need info pretaining to replacing the cam chain and maybe pulling the head. Thanks

If you have a K&N air filter you will have to re jet it for the extra air flow, that may have something to do with it not wanting to idle and back firing.
